Understanding Content Governance in Corporate Blogs
Content governance refers to the systematic approach that organizations undertake to manage their content production and maintenance. In the realm of corporate blogs, this involves setting guidelines and standards to ensure that all published material aligns with the company’s voice, style, and objectives. Effective content governance helps in maintaining consistency across all blog posts, which is essential for establishing and reinforcing brand identity.
A well-defined governance framework ensures that the content is not only consistent but also compliant with legal and ethical standards. This includes adhering to copyright laws, ensuring factual accuracy, and maintaining transparency with the audience. By implementing these protocols, companies can prevent potential legal issues and build trust with their readers.
Moreover, content governance plays a crucial role in optimizing content for search engines. By standardizing practices like keyword usage, meta descriptions, and alt text for images, companies can improve their search engine rankings. This not only enhances visibility but also drives more traffic to the blog, making it an effective tool for lead generation and customer engagement.
Key Elements of Effective Content Governance
Effective content governance is built upon several key elements, each contributing to the overall quality and efficacy of the corporate blog. Content Strategy forms the foundation, outlining the purpose, target audience, and key messages that the blog aims to convey. A well-devised strategy ensures that every piece of content serves a clear objective and aligns with the company’s broader goals.
Editorial Guidelines are another critical component, providing a set of rules and standards for writing, formatting, and publishing content. These guidelines ensure consistency in tone, style, and quality, making the blog easily recognizable and relatable to its audience. They also help in maintaining a professional appearance, which is crucial for brand credibility.
Content Audits and Reviews are essential for maintaining the relevancy and accuracy of the blog content. Regular audits help identify outdated or underperforming posts, providing opportunities for updates or improvements. A structured review process, involving editors and subject matter experts, ensures that each piece meets quality standards before publication, thereby minimizing errors and enhancing overall content quality.
Strategies for Maintaining Blog Quality
To maintain the quality of a corporate blog, companies can employ several strategies centered around their governance framework. Firstly, investing in Training and Development for content creators is essential. This can involve workshops, seminars, and online courses focused on writing skills, SEO techniques, and understanding industry trends. By equipping team members with the necessary skills, companies ensure that their content remains competitive and engaging.
Another effective strategy is implementing Content Management Systems (CMS) that facilitate seamless content creation, editing, and publishing. A robust CMS can streamline workflows, enhance collaboration among team members, and provide analytics to monitor performance metrics. This not only improves efficiency but also ensures that the blog content is consistently high-quality and aligned with governance protocols.
Lastly, fostering a culture of Continuous Improvement is crucial for sustaining blog quality. Encouraging feedback from both internal teams and external audiences can provide valuable insights into what works and what doesn’t. By regularly reviewing and refining content strategies and governance practices based on this feedback, companies can adapt to changing market conditions and audience preferences, thereby maintaining a dynamic and relevant corporate blog.
Challenges in Implementing Governance Practices
Despite its benefits, implementing content governance practices in corporate blogs comes with its own set of challenges. One major challenge is the Resistance to Change from team members, particularly if they are accustomed to informal or ad-hoc content creation processes. Overcoming this resistance requires clear communication about the benefits of governance and how it contributes to the blog’s success.
Another challenge is the Complexity of Coordination among various stakeholders involved in the content creation process. This includes writers, editors, legal advisors, and marketing teams, each with their own priorities and perspectives. Establishing clear roles and responsibilities, along with effective project management tools, can help streamline coordination and ensure that everyone is aligned with governance objectives.
Finally, there is the issue of Resource Constraints, as implementing a robust content governance framework can be time-consuming and costly. Smaller organizations, in particular, may struggle to allocate the necessary resources for training, technology, and personnel. To address this, companies can prioritize key aspects of governance that align with their immediate objectives and gradually expand their efforts as resources allow.
